Re: .stl to .cube3 conversion

Quote:
Originally Posted by maxnz View Post
Team 2855 is trying to print our logo on our Ekocycle Cube printer. We have found that the current version of the Cubify software will not convert the file. We are wondering if anyone else has an older version of Cubify and would be willing to convert it for us. You can PM me and I can get the file to you.

Or, if anyone knows how to get the printer to recognize and print .stl files or any other type of standard file.

Thanks
If the ekocycle is like most lower-end FDM printers that I am familiar with, it won't be able to print directly from an STL, it must be sliced first. If the ekocyce software won't accept STL, you'd likely have to export from your CAD software it to a different file type, like .obj.
